Tidying
authorNeil Smith <neil.git@njae.me.uk>
Fri, 20 Dec 2019 17:46:17 +0000 (17:46 +0000)
committerNeil Smith <neil.git@njae.me.uk>
Fri, 20 Dec 2019 17:46:17 +0000 (17:46 +0000)
advent16/src/advent16.hs

index 816def5fdbd80a2f9ccdd9cc6e1ff28261af9cd1..2067d13996fd82c01ef22c7bf1b87a0341627d38 100644 (file)
@@ -1,14 +1,5 @@
-import Debug.Trace
-
 import Data.Char (digitToInt, intToDigit)
 
--- import qualified Data.Map.Strict as M
--- import Data.Map.Strict ((!))
-import Data.List
--- import qualified Data.Set as S
-
-
-
 main :: IO ()
 main = do 
         text <- readFile "data/advent16.txt"
@@ -21,6 +12,7 @@ main = do
 part1 :: [Int] -> String
 part1 digits = map intToDigit $ take 8 $ (fft digits)!!100
 
+part2 :: [Int] -> String
 part2 digits = map intToDigit signal
     where offset = read @Int $ map intToDigit $ take 7 digits 
           fullDigits = concat $ replicate 10000 digits